推荐文章:OAuth2-Proxy部署利器——manifests项目

推荐文章:OAuth2-Proxy部署利器——manifests项目

manifestsFor hosting manifests to allow for the deployment of OAuth2-Proxy/OAuth2-Proxy项目地址:https://gitcode.com/gh_mirrors/man/manifests

项目介绍

在当今云原生和微服务架构大行其道的时代,安全访问控制变得尤为重要。manifests项目正是为了解决这一痛点而来,它专注于托管必要的配置文件,以实现OAuth2-Proxy的便捷部署,从而加强你的应用安全性。该项目提供了详细的Helm Chart,简化了在Kubernetes环境中的部署流程,使得开发者能够更加聚焦于业务逻辑本身,而不是繁复的安全配置细节。

项目技术分析

manifests项目基于已废弃的helm/stable仓库中的社区版oauth2-proxy Helm Chart进行开发和维护。这标志着它不仅继承了一流的部署实践,而且在其基础上进行了优化和升级,确保了与最新 Kubernetes 版本的兼容性和最佳实践。通过利用Helm Chart测试工具(chart-testing),项目团队确保每次部署都是经过严格验证的,保证了部署过程的稳定性和可靠性。项目支持本地运行的 lint 和 validation 测试,进一步增强了开发者的信心和效率。

项目及技术应用场景

应用场景:

  • 企业级Web服务:对于那些需要保护内部或对外提供的Web应用程序的企业,manifests可轻松集成到现有的Kubernetes集群中,提供一层额外的身份验证和授权保障。
  • 微服务安全网关:在微服务架构中,每个服务都可以视为潜在的入口点,manifests配合OAuth2-Proxy有助于构建统一的认证层,防止未经授权访问服务。
  • 云原生安全增强:在云端部署的应用可以通过该项目快速启用OAuth2协议,对接现有的身份管理解决方案,如Google身份验证、Azure AD等,增强应用的安全性。

技术应用:

  • OAuth2认证: 实现非侵入式用户认证,无需修改后端服务即可增加登录功能。
  • 单点登录(SSO): 促进多应用间的无缝认证体验,提升用户体验。
  • 基于角色的访问控制(RBAC): 结合Kubernetes的RBAC机制,细化权限管理,确保资源安全。

项目特点

  1. 易用性:通过精心设计的Helm Chart,即使是初学者也能快速上手,一键部署OAuth2-Proxy。
  2. 高兼容性:与最新的Kubernetes版本保持兼容,确保部署过程平滑无阻。
  3. 安全性强化:采用OAuth2标准,大大提高了应用的访问安全性,尤其适合敏感数据的保护。
  4. 社区支持:依托GitHub和Artifact Hub的活跃社区,持续获得更新和问题解答。
  5. 自动化测试:通过chart-testing工具确保代码质量和部署的稳定性,减少人为错误。

总之,manifests项目是面向现代云环境的一项重要工具,尤其是对Kubernetes使用者来说,它为实现高效、安全的OAuth2代理部署提供了快捷路径。无论是大型企业还是初创公司,通过该工具都能快速搭建起强大且安全的认证体系,让你的应用安全无忧。立刻加入,享受安全部署的新体验吧!


markdown 格式的推荐文章结束,希望对你有帮助!

manifestsFor hosting manifests to allow for the deployment of OAuth2-Proxy/OAuth2-Proxy项目地址:https://gitcode.com/gh_mirrors/man/manifests

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

祁婉菲Flora

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值